Solving order cancellations with BuyForMe

A common hurdle for shoppers in China is the strict payment security protocols used by major US retailers. Many popular stores, including Sephora and Glossier, frequently block international credit cards or automatically decline orders that are flagged as going to a freight forwarder. This can be incredibly frustrating when you are trying to secure a limited-edition launch like You Fleur.

Setting up shipping to China

Once your order is secured, you need a reliable way to get it to your doorstep. Understanding how it works is simple: you provide the retailer with a tax-free us address provided by comGateway. Your package is delivered to a warehouse in Oregon, where sales tax is 0%, saving you money immediately on the purchase price.

From the warehouse, you can manage your international shipping service preferences. Perfumes are classified as sensitive items due to their alcohol content, so using an experienced provider ensures that all safety regulations are met for ship to China requests. Your items will be carefully repacked and prepared for long-haul transit to ensure they arrive in perfect condition.
